The vapor pressure of a series of perfluoropolyethers (PFPEs) was estimated from the weight loss measured in a standard thermogravimetric analyzer (TGA). A relation linking the coefficients describing the vapor pressure dependence on temperature to the molecular weight was obtained from the data measured on fractions with a narrow molecular weight distribution. Based on this relation, a simple method predicting the vapor pressure of a mixture of PFPEs from the molecular weight distribution can be applied to the whole range of grades.
► TGA standard equipment can be used to estimate vapor pressure and enthalpy of vaporization.
► The vapor pressure of a series of PFPEs was measured to obtain the enthalpies of vaporization.
► A general Clausius Clapeyron's relation can be established with parameters depending on the molecular weight.
► The obtained relation is checked on samples with broad molecular weight distribution.
